Does the denial by one of the parties of the existence of a partnership affect the court's jurisdiction to appoint an arbitrator based on an arbitration clause contained in a contract between them?

The denial by one of the parties of the existence of a partnership does not affect the court's jurisdiction to appoint an arbitrator based on an arbitration clause contained in a contract between them, provided that the existence of the contract and the arbitration clause is established.
